Understanding the Parker Pilot Valve 50HB

The Parker Pilot Valve 50HB is a precision-engineered hydraulic control valve developed by Parker Hannifin, a globally recognized leader in motion and control technologies. It’s designed to regulate hydraulic pressure and flow, ensuring stable operation of vital shipboard systems such as propulsion, steering, winches, cranes, and engine control mechanisms.

In marine environments, where hydraulic systems are exposed to continuous vibration, high pressure, and saltwater corrosion, the 50HB stands out as a dependable solution. It provides precise control, minimizes energy loss, and prevents failures that could lead to costly downtime or mechanical damage.

Engineering Design That Promotes Reliability

The Parker Pilot Valve 50HB’s design is built around the core principle of operational reliability. Every feature contributes to improved performance, stability, and durability, ensuring it can withstand the harshest marine conditions.

1. Rugged Construction for Extreme Environments

Marine operations demand components that can perform reliably under fluctuating pressures and temperatures. The Parker 50HB is made from corrosion-resistant materials that ensure longevity, even when exposed to salt-laden air and seawater.

2. Precision Pressure Control

The valve maintains consistent hydraulic pressure, preventing pressure spikes or drops that can lead to equipment malfunction or fatigue. This precision control ensures smoother operation and longer service life for connected systems.

3. Compact and Modular Design

Its space-saving design makes it easy to install in compact engine rooms or hydraulic control panels. The modularity also allows for quick maintenance or replacement without disrupting entire systems.

4. Advanced Sealing Technology

One of the most common causes of hydraulic system failure is fluid leakage. Parker’s advanced sealing technology in the 50HB prevents internal and external leaks, maintaining stable performance and minimizing maintenance needs.

5. High-Temperature and Pressure Tolerance

The valve is capable of performing reliably under extreme pressures and high-temperature conditions — ideal for the heavy-duty demands of marine propulsion and deck machinery systems.

The Parker Pilot Valve 50HB in Key Marine Applications

The versatility of the Parker 50HB makes it a critical component across multiple marine systems. Each application benefits uniquely from its reliability-enhancing features.

1. Propulsion Systems

In marine propulsion, maintaining precise hydraulic control is essential for consistent power delivery. The Parker 50HB ensures the propulsion system operates smoothly, reducing mechanical strain and enhancing overall fuel efficiency.

2. Steering Gear Systems

For navigation safety, steering systems must respond instantly and accurately. The 50HB helps maintain steady hydraulic pressure in the steering gear, improving maneuverability and minimizing steering lag or errors.

3. Deck Machinery and Cranes

Cargo operations rely on dependable deck machinery. The Parker 50HB ensures hydraulic equipment like winches and cranes operate without interruption, even during continuous heavy-load cycles.
